  • Great Video Steve, How does the 817 do with moisture.

  • So far so good, but it's not rated waterproof or even water resistant so keeping it protected from moisture is always a concern. I recently lost an HT to water damage so I know it can happen!

  • Thanks, I have a good friend K0NK , Jim who is a avid backpacker and we have kept CW schedules for years with him while he is backpacking in the mountains of Colorado and Wyoming. He uses a Heath HW 8 and has mentioned there have been times when water got into the radio and it survived. We were talking about how the 817 would do with its high impedance circuitry if it got even a little wet.
